ASTER CAFE at LAKE AUSTIN SPA RESORT
LAKE AUSTIN SPA RESORT: Lake Austin Spa Resort is nationally recognized as being one of the top spas in the world, including the coveted…
LAKE AUSTIN SPA RESORT: Lake Austin Spa Resort is nationally recognized as being one of the top spas in the world, including the coveted…